The short version

With 206 people, Bulpitt is a city in Illinois. At a median age of 45.5, this is an older place than the country as a whole. 7%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, below the 24% national rate. 83% of homes are owner-occupied. Median home value sits at $39,200. Households here earn about 36% less than in Illinois as a whole.
